What Is Certificate Attestation?
Certificate attestation is the official process of confirming that a document is genuine. It involves authentication by multiple government bodies, embassies, and the UAE Ministry of Foreign Affairs. Once attested, your document becomes legally valid for use in the UAE.
This process applies to educational, personal, and commercial documents.

Indian Certificate Attestation Process
Many UAE residents come from India, making indian certificate attestation in dubai one of the most commonly requested services. This applies to educational and personal certificates issued in India.
The process usually involves:
Notary verification in India
State-level authentication
Ministry of External Affairs (MEA) attestation
UAE Embassy attestation
MOFA stamping in the UAE
Each stage confirms the legitimacy of the document.

What Is True Copy Attestation?
Sometimes, authorities require certified copies instead of original documents. This is known as true copy attestation in dubai, where an authorized official certifies that the photocopy matches the original document.
True copy attestation is often required for:
Bank applications
Court submissions
Property transactions
Corporate registrations
It helps protect original documents while still meeting legal requirements.
